Output 2cc642ae4e94de6b3f36abf18a0e2d8ffe6a67359cf33191343b016721d78ad1:5

value
120569586
script pubkey
OP_0 OP_PUSHBYTES_32 848b0428de7bc29961c8e9ee73635f4fed44ea9c565feccfd1b520facca24f3f
address
bc1qsj9sg2x700pfjcwga8h8xc6lflk5f65u2e07en73k5s04n9zfulsej0zn8
transaction
2cc642ae4e94de6b3f36abf18a0e2d8ffe6a67359cf33191343b016721d78ad1
confirmations
192598
spent
true